Can some one point out to me what I am missing? I suspect I have
messed up the if/else some how. I am getting a ''
Syntax error at ''{''; expected ''}'' at
/srv/puppet/production/manifests/modules/apache/init.pp: 19''.
According to the Language tutorial this should be correct. I am
testing for an existence of a variable. If it exists chagne the config
files to use it, if not set it to the apache default.
My init.pp:
class apache{
if $docroot{
# Set Document Root to the new directory.
line{"$docroot":
file => "/etc/http/conf/httpd.conf",
line => ''DocumentRoot
"/var/www/html"'',
ensure => comment,
}
file{"$docroot.conf":
path =>
"/etc/http/conf.d/DocumentRoot.conf",
content =>''# This file sets the webserver
Document Root
# dir for Apache.
DocumentRoot "$docroot"'',
require => Line["$docroot"],
}
}
else {
$docroot = "/var/www/html"
} #<<< This Line
19.
$packages =
{"httpd","mod_ssl","webalizer"}
package{$packages:
ensure => present,
}
file{$docroot:
ensure => directory,
mode => 755,
}
}

On Apr 24, 2008, at 4:40 PM, Evan Hisey wrote:> file{"$docroot.conf": > path => "/etc/http/conf.d/DocumentRoot.conf", > content =>''# This file sets the webserver > Document Root > # dir for Apache. > DocumentRoot "$docroot"'',There''s currently a filed bug about carriage returns in strings not counting against the line count. This string is messing up your line count.> > require => Line["$docroot"], > } > } > else { > $docroot = "/var/www/html" > } #<<< This > Line 19. > > $packages = {"httpd","mod_ssl","webalizer"}This is not how you specify an array; use []. -- Work is not always required.
